Output 6416035e7f2da523db68fea5ac9d3c7a15eb0e285f71257f9d184e71263d0c39:0

value
77000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 057809c0a21a601a7fdbf8105ae1f95c28536b32 OP_EQUAL
address
32Bw6tvR111zXnguLXPWvwuEroUtgqXw5Q
transaction
6416035e7f2da523db68fea5ac9d3c7a15eb0e285f71257f9d184e71263d0c39